The Basics.....

1. We have broken God's Holy Laws (The 10 Commandments) By lying, stealing, committing adultery in our hearts through lusting, blaspheming by taking God's name in vain, murdering in our hearts through hatred of others, etc. (Bible says all liars will have their part in the lake of fire. No theif, no adulterer, no murderer etc., will ever set foot in the Kingdom of God)

2. And so, we are wretched sinners and God's enemies - doing nothing but storing up wrath for the day of judgment.

3. Jesus came to reconcile us to the Father by dying on the cross on our behalf, taking our punishment upon himself, to pay the price for our sin in his life's blood. (i.e., Sin = death. No forgivness of sin without the shedding on blood).

4. By repenting of our sins (asking forgivness and turning away from our lifestyle of sin) and placing our faith in JESUS ALONE to save us, we will be born again and become children of God and citizens of Heaven.

5. We are then commanded to share the Gospel with everyone we can.
